Stem Cell Therapy for a Childhood Brain White Matter Disorder

Projectomschrijving

Hersen wittestofziekten komen op alle leeftijden voor. Op de kinderleeftijd zijn het vooral genetische ziekten, die leiden tot progressieve neurologische handicap en vroeg overlijden. Er is op dit moment geen behandeling. Wij proberen met “wittestofstamcellen” de ziekten tot staan te brengen en zo mogelijk de witte stof te genezen. Eerder uitgevoerde
stamceltransplantatiestudies zijn zeer veelbelovend. Gebruik van embryonale stamcellen is geassocieerd met ethische problemen zoals gebruik van embryo’s en afstoting van niet-lichaamseigen cellen. Om deze reden willen wij uitgaan van huidkweekcellen (fibroblasten) van de patiënten, deze reprogrammeren naar immature stamcellen, en vervolgens differentiëren naar voorlopercellen van de wittestof. De wittestofstamcellen kunnen voor transplantatie gebruikt worden. We hebben hier tot doel celtransplantatie te testen in een muismodel voor een veel voorkomende genetische wittestofziekte bij kinderen.

Samenvatting van de aanvraag

“White matter disorders” have many different causes and affect patients of all ages. Childhood white matter disorders are most often genetic and progressive. Affected children have mental and motor disabilities. They need special care and education, physical therapies, rehabilitation, and special housing. They die after years of increasing handicap. The overall incidence of childhood white matter disorders is 1:1000-2000. We focus on childhood white matter disorders in general, and on the autosomal recessive leukodystrophy Vanishing White Matter Disease (VWM) in particular. Patients with VWM show increasing neurological dysfunction and die after years of illness. Neuropathologic abnormalities indicate a selective disruption of glia (both oligodendrocytes and astrocytes) in the cerebral white matter. Currently there is no treatment available. Transplantation of stem cells, primed to become glia, in early stages of the disease may halt further progression and repair (part of) the existing damage. We have generated new representative mouse models for VWM. The homozygous mice show ataxia, sporadic epileptic seizures, and die around 7 months of age. Histopathologic analysis shows lack of myelin, dysmorphic astrocytes and presence of immature cells, which are also the hallmarks of histopathology in human VWM patients. These mice offer us excellent models to test cell replacement therapies. To bring us closer towards developing personalized cell replacement therapies, we are using induced pluripotent stem (iPS) cells. If a cell replacement approach will prove to work in the human nervous system, cell transplantation therapy will become an important new strategy in treating severe neurological disorders. The research questions of this proposal are whether 1) the VWM-microenvironment affects neural stem cell differentiation and 2) transplantation of glial precursor populations into a mouse model for VWM halts progression of the disease or leads to recovery of the affected white matter.
